A Morning Drive

Andy, his son Drew, and I set off to explore the numerous yard sales around the Staunton area Saturday morning. Since I rode shotgun, my job was to spot signs and call out addresses. Evidently sale season is in full effect, as signs hung on every tenth telephone pole. Taking full effect or clustering, many yards in a single neighborhood held sales. I wanted to capture some of the day with my camera, although I didn’t have any particular items in mind to look out for.

Andy collects vintage video game systems. The sales were on fire this day, and as the morning wore on he came away with an Atari 2600 with games, and a Pokemon N64 of some value. I gained a couple of tool bags and a couple of nice butcher knives.

Shenandoah Heritage Market

After lunch in Harrisonburg at Quaker Steak and Lube, we returned south on Hwy 11 to Staunton. On the way we stopped at Shenandoah Heritage Market for some treats. The market features crafts, antiques, and local foods. I brought some fudge and took a few photos.
